이 구절의 의미
This verse tells us that the glory of Ephraim will disappear quickly, like a bird flying away. It's about how they won't have children or descendants anymore because their population will decline rapidly.

역사적 배경
The book of Hosea was written by the prophet Hosea in the 8th century BCE during the decline of the Northern Kingdom of Israel, whose main tribe was Ephraim. The audience is primarily Ephraim and surrounding tribes, addressing their declining status due to disobedience.
